Wedding invitation ettiquette? Was this rude? |
Yesterday I received an invitation to wedding. The groom-to-be is a relative. It was addressed to Ms. Sally Smith, rather than to my formal name of Mrs. Richard Smith. My husband is deceased and while Ms. is appropriate in business situations, I'm really put off being called Ms. in such formal social situations. Oh, just in case anyone is wondering, I'm not really old or anything, early 40s. it is proper to address the invitation to yourself, though a widower is usual addressed as you have stated, u r correct, and guest, otherwise you are not properly given the option to invite someone. I can definitely see your point, and I am sorry for your loss. The thing with your relative and invitation is that the engaged couple probably thought about it quite a bit before deciding on how to address you and if they should invite a guest for you. It's a difficult situation, and they may have been thinking that since your husband passed, you would not like to bring a guest. That's presumptuous, of course, but it's an idea. Maybe they felt that addressing the invitation to your late husband's name would seem offensive or rude to you. I'm not sure, but I do think that you could bring a guest either way, as long as you make them aware. Sometimes in situations like that, were someone deceased is involved, people aren't really sure how to address the other person. And usually they decide to go with something more neutral, like calling you Ms. Sally Smith rather than by your married name. While this may be offensive to you, I think their intentions weren't meant to be rude. They were uninformed of your preference and probably thought they were doing the right thing.
